What youโ€™ll need to doโ€ฆ

  • In a small bowl, mix together the mayonnaise, chopped parsley, dried oregano. Spread this herbed mayo onto one side of each slice of sourdough bread.
  • Next, assemble your gourmet grilled cheese by layering the herbed mayo side with caramelized onions, gruyere cheese, arugula and gouda. Top each sandwich with the remaining slice of sourdough bread, creating a flavorful sandwich.
  • In a non-stick frying pan over medium-low heat, place the sandwiches with the buttered side down. Cook until both sides turn a glorius golden-brown and achieve a delightful crispiness, approximately 6-7 minutes per side..
  • Serve your mouthwatering creation alongside cherry tomatoes or a simple salad for a perfect balance of flavors. Get ready to savor every cheesy, caramalized, and herbed bite of this gourmet grilled cheese masterpiece!

Some useful tipsโ€ฆ

Here are some useful tips to enhance your experience while making the โ€œCaramelized Onion, Arugula & Herbed Mayo Gourmet Grilled Cheeseโ€:

  1. Perfect Caramelization: Take your time when caramelizing onions. Slow and low heat will bring out their natural sweetness, giving your sandwich a rich flavor.
  2. Cheese Selection: Experiment with different cheese combinations to find your favorite blend. Mix and match textures and flavors for a unique twist.
  3. Herbed Mayo Magic: Let the herbed mayo sit for a few minutes after mixing. This allows the flavors to meld, enhancing the overall taste.
  4. Bread Thickness: Adjust the thickness of your bread slices based on personal preference. Thicker slices will result in a heartier bite, while thinner slices may crisp up more quickly.
  5. Preheat the Pan: Ensure the frying pan is properly preheated before adding the sandwiches. This helps achieve that desirable golden-brown crispiness.
  6. Butter Evenly: Spread butter evenly on the bread to ensure a consistent and golden crust. This also helps prevent any part of the bread from becoming too greasy.
  7. Pressing the Sandwich: Consider using a panini press or a heavy skillet to gently press the sandwich while cooking. This helps to compact the ingredients and creates a satisfying crunch.
  8. Freshness Matters: Serve the grilled cheese immediately for the best texture and flavor. The contrast of warm, melty cheese with crisp bread is irresistible.
  9. Tomato Toppings: If serving with cherry tomatoes, a sprinkle of salt and pepper or a drizzle of balsamic glaze can enhance their natural sweetness.
  10. Customize to Taste: Donโ€™t be afraid to add your personal touch! Whether itโ€™s a dash of hot sauce or a sprinkle of your favorite seasoning, make it your own.

Some storage suggestions

While the best way to enjoy a gourmet grilled cheese is fresh off the pan, here are some storage suggestions in case you have leftovers or need to prepare in advance:

  1. Refrigeration:
    • If you have leftover grilled cheese, store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ator. This helps maintain its texture and prevents it from becoming soggy.
  2. Individual Wrapping:
    • Wrap individual grilled cheese sandwiches in parchment paper or aluminum foil before refrigerating. This prevents them from sticking together and preserves their crispy exterior.
  3. Reheating:
    • To reheat, use a toaster oven or oven at a low temperature (around 325ยฐF or 163ยฐC) to help retain the crispiness. Avoid using a microwave, as it can make the bread soggy.
  4. Freezing:
    • Grilled cheese can be frozen for longer storage. Wrap each sandwich tightly in plastic wrap or foil and place them in a freezer-safe bag. Label with the date for easy tracking.
  5. Thawing:
    • When ready to enjoy a frozen grilled cheese, allow it to thaw in the refrigerator overnight. Reheat in the oven for best results.
  6. Caramelized Onions:
    • If youโ€™ve made extra caramelized onions, store them separately in an airtight container. They can be refrigerated for a few days or frozen for longer storage.
  7. Prep Ingredients in Advance:
    • Prepare the herbed mayo and caramelized onions ahead of time to streamline the assembly process. Store them in separate containers in the refrigerator.
  8. Avoid Moisture:
    • Keep the grilled cheese away from moisture, as it can compromise the crispiness. Use absorbent materials like paper towels in the storage container.

Remember that while reheating can bring back some of the sandwichโ€™s glory, the texture may not match the freshly made version. Instructions

  1. In a small bowl, combine the mayonnaise, parsley, and dried oregano.

    Gourmet Grilled Cheese Gourmet Grilled Cheese

  2. Butter the outside of the slices of sourdough bread.

  3. Assemble the sandwich by layering the herbed mayo, caramelized onions, gruyere, arugula, and gouda between the non-buttered sides of the bread.

    Gourmet Grilled Cheese Gourmet Grilled Cheese Gourmet Grilled Cheese Gourmet Grilled Cheese Gourmet Grilled Cheese

  4. Place the sandwich buttered side down on a non-stick frying pan and place over medium-low heat. Cook until golden-brown and crispy on both sides, approximately 6-7 minutes per side.

    Gourmet Grilled Cheese Gourmet Grilled Cheese

  5. Serve alongside cherry tomatoes or a simple salad. Enjoy!

Frequently Asked Questions

Expand All:
Can I refrigerate the assembled grilled cheese sandwich for later?

Yes, you can refrigerate the assembled grilled cheese sandwich. Store it in an airtight container to maintain its its freshness. However, keep in mind that the texture may change, and it's best to reheat in an oven for optimal crispiness.

How long can I keep leftover grilled cheese in the refrigerator?

Leftover grilled cheese can be refrigerated for up to 2-3 days. Make sure to store it properly in an airtight container or wrap it individually to preserve its flavor and texture.

Can I freeze grilled cheese for longer storage?

Absolutely! Individually wrap the grilled cheese in plastic wrap or foil before placing them in a freezer-safe bag. Properly stored, grilled cheese can be frozen for up to 1-2 months.

What's the best way to reheat grilled cheese without losing its crispness?

To reheat grilled cheese, use a toaster oven or conventional oven at a low temperature (around 325ยฐF or 163ยฐC). Avoid using a microwave, as it may result in a soggy texture.

Can I freeze the caramelized onions separately?

Yes, you can freeze caramelized onions separately in an airtight container or freezer-safe bag. Thaw them in the refrigerator when needed and reheat gently on the stovetop.

How do I prevfent the bread from becoming soggy during storage?

To prevent the bread from becoming soggy, use absorbent materials like paper towels in the storage container. Additionally, keep the grilled cheese away from moisture.

Can I prepare the herbed mayo and caramelized onions in advance?

Absolutely! Prepare the herbed mayo and caramelized onions in advance and store them separately in airtight containers in the refrigerator. This can save time when assembling the sandwiches.

What's the recommended method for thawing frozen grilled cheese?

Thaw frozen grilled cheese in the refrigerator overnight. Reheat it in the oven for the best results, ensuring a crispy exterior and melty interior.
